Consistency and Nkemdiche rarely are in the same sentence, and that dates to his college career at Mississippi.
My memory isn't so bad after all.

Then again, it isn't that good either.
Nkemdiche was regarded as a top-10 prospect, but he fell to the bottom of the round because of concerns about his character. In his final year at Mississippi, he was suspended for the Sugar Bowl after he broke a window at an Atlanta hotel and took a 15-foot fall off a wall. He was charged with marijuana possession.

At the scouting combine that spring, Nkemdiche faced the same question from team after team, including the Cardinals.

“It’s my character,” he said then. “Some have asked about my production of course, but it’s mostly my character, off-the-field commitment. I’ve cleared it up with every team. I just plan to keep moving forward.”
